The Cisco WVC210 Wireless-G Pan Tilt Zoom Internet Video Camera helps you monitor and protect your critical business assets from anywhere in the world. View and control the camera's full pan, tilt, and zoom capabilities with your web browser.
Dual codecs in this versatile camera provide flexibility in determining image quality versus storage and bandwidth requirements. The Cisco WVC210 camera supports a number of connection protocols, so you can view images on everything from 3G and Wi-Fi phones to PCs.
Additional features include:
- Support for recording in low-light environments (1 Lux at F2.0)
- Two-way audio alongside an embedded microphone, external speaker, and microphone ports
- Up to 10 simultaneous connections for remote viewing
- 1/4-inch complementary metal oxide semiconductor sensor
- Simultaneous MPEG-4 and MJPEG encoding
- Real Time Streaming Protocol for video and audio
- Third Generation Partnership Project for video viewing on 3G mobile phones
- Motion detection with event notifications
